Fee hikes sought for hunting, fishing licenses (The Mail Tribune)
Recreational hunting and fishing license fees would climb about 20 percent beginning in 2010 as part of a nearly $300 million budget recommendation to fund Oregon Department of Fish and Wildlife operations in 2009-11.

S.D. commission approves mountain lion hunting season (The Bismarck Tribune)
PIERRE, S.D. (AP) - The South Dakota Game, Fish and Parks Commission has approved a hunting season on mountain lions that would start two months later than last year in an attempt to reduce the number of young lions orphaned when their mothers are killed.

Free Fishing Educates Participants About Epilepsy (KTHV Little Rock)
Kids and parents gathered this morning at lake Cherrywood Park in Sherwood for a free fishing derby. The event was sponsored by Parents Educating Arkansas About Children with Epilepsy and featured pro anglers from the women's Bassmaster tour.
